Output 81e16fdceac23fce4264e074cb4070e510248aaa2ddc3761a222bd55970b6ab2:1

value
26083289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4393f5a5dc8ca73a696866495c3fe48ec15171d OP_EQUAL
address
MUhtsnsNxNxp1HmdzdACshnJyG7zDvGLF1
transaction
81e16fdceac23fce4264e074cb4070e510248aaa2ddc3761a222bd55970b6ab2
spent
true